About this study

Postoperative nausea and vomiting (PONV) is common after thyroid surgery. Many patients describe PONV as more irritant in the postoperative course than the endured pain. Postoperative drains are put after thyroid surgery to early recognize bleeding and to collect wound secretion to avoid pressure on the trachea. Whether wound drains do impact on PONV is not known. Therefore, we tested the impact of wound drains on PONV after thyroid- and parathyroid surgery in a randomized controlled clinical trial.

Treatment and study plan

Placement of a wound drain post surgery (Redon; Medicoplast)

Device

The wound drain, type Redon Drainage 3.0 mm in diameter

Other names: Redon Drainage (Ref. 750), 3.0 mm in diameter, Medicoplast, 66557 Illingen, Germany

No-drain after surgery

Other

After surgery, no drain was put

Secondary outcomes

  1. Antiemetic therapy post surgery in patients with and without postoperative drainage

    Time frame: after 48 hours

    In the postoperative course, we counted the amount of anti-emetic interventions for patients post surgery over the first 48 hours. The givage of anti-emetic drugs was based on a prior determined protocol, that was strictly followed.

    The protocol was as follows for antiemetic drugs:

    First line Drug: Tropisetron 2 mg i.v. when patient is vomiting, max. twice a day. Second line therapy: Haloperidol 0.5 mg i.v. with a maximum of 3 mg every 24 hours, when first line therapy is not sufficient. The change to second line therapy is controlled by the study physician.
